While foxhunting dominates the popular imagination, it is important to remember that there are still around sixty organised harrier, beagle and basset packs that solely target hares. Leveret killed by Easton Harriers, 2018. Hare hunts tend to pack up when sabs appear as they cannot sustain the lie of ‘trail hunting’. On several occasions, hare hunters have laid scent trails in front of sabs, only for the hounds to ignore them and tear after hares instead. Instead, they now frequently claim to be hunting rabbits which is, of course, a nonsense as rabbits will bolt into a burrow at the first signs of danger. Another even more ridiculous ruse is to claim that they are searching for hares that have previously been shot. These loopholes need to be closed!
